How to Maintain Your Squeeze Action Clamps
Proper maintenance of squeeze action clamps is crucial for ensuring their longevity and optimal performance. A consistent cleaning routine can prevent debris buildup, which can interfere with the smooth operation of the clamp. After each use, wipe down the clamps with a cloth to remove any sawdust, glue, or other residues. If your clamps are particularly grimy, a mild soap solution can help, but be sure to dry them thoroughly to prevent rust, especially if they are made of metal.
Inspecting the clamps regularly for wear and tear is also essential. Pay attention to the moving parts, including the trigger mechanism and the pivot points. If you notice any signs of rust or corrosion, address these issues promptly. Applying a light machine oil to the hinges and moving parts can help prevent rust and ensure smooth operation. It’s also wise to check the rubber grips; if they become slippery or damaged, replacing them can greatly enhance comfort and safety during use.
Finally, storing your clamps properly can significantly extend their lifespan. Keep them in a dry, cool place, away from direct sunlight and humidity. Consider using a dedicated storage rack or organizer to prevent them from becoming tangled or damaged. By following these maintenance tips, your squeeze action clamps will remain effective tools for years to come.

Specialty Squeeze Action Clamps and Their Uses
While many squeeze action clamps are designed for general use, specialty clamps offer targeted solutions for specific tasks or materials. For instance, spreader clamps are an excellent choice for projects that require spreading two pieces apart rather than clamping them together. They can often be adjusted to accommodate various widths, making them highly versatile for woodworking and assembly projects. These clamps are particularly useful when preparing materials for gluing or fitting components together.
Another type of specialty clamp is the corner clamp, which is designed to hold two pieces of wood at a right angle. This is especially important in frame construction, cabinetry, and other projects where precise angles are essential. Corner clamps often feature adjustable settings to accommodate different thicknesses, providing consistent and secure joints without the need for additional tools.
Pipe clamps are another specialty option worth noting, particularly among woodworkers and DIY enthusiasts. They can accommodate larger panels or boards, making them ideal for gluing or assembling furniture pieces. Pipe clamps consist of a length of pipe and various clamping heads, allowing for great flexibility and strength. Their versatility makes them a popular choice for larger woodworking projects, providing ample clamping pressure while maintaining an even distribution across the surface. Whether you choose standard or specialty clamps, understanding their specific uses can enhance your project outcomes.

3. Are there different types of squeeze action clamps?
Yes, there are several types of squeeze action clamps available on the market, each designed for specific applications. Common types include spring clamps, trigger clamps, and toggle clamps. Spring clamps operate using a simple spring mechanism that allows them to be opened and closed rapidly, making them ideal for light-duty tasks.
Trigger clamps are designed with a ratchet mechanism that provides more pressure and support for heavier projects, while toggle clamps offer a locking feature that ensures a solid grip on larger items. Each type of clamp has its unique advantages, so it’s important to evaluate your project needs to select the appropriate type of squeeze action clamp.

5. Can squeeze action clamps damage my workpieces?
While squeeze action clamps are designed to provide strong gripping power, improper usage can lead to damage, particularly if excessive force is applied. It’s crucial to understand the material you are working with and adjust the pressure accordingly. For instance, softer woods or delicate materials may get crushed or dented if clamped too tightly.
To mitigate the risk of damage, consider using clamps with padded jaws or adding protective materials between the clamp and your workpiece. This will help distribute the clamping pressure more evenly and prevent marring or deformation of the surface. Always monitor the pressure during use to ensure that you achieve a secure grip without compromising the integrity of your project.
